Title :
Properties of the thermo-field ion-electron (I-F-T) emission

Abstract :
The paper considers peculiarities of the thermo-field (F-T) mechanism of electron emission occurring under conditions of the vacuum arc cathode spot. The problem of the effect of individual fields of ions arriving at the cathode on the side of plasma on the additional outcome of electrons as a result of local deformation of a potential barrier near the surface is formulated. Expressions were derived to determine the number of the emitted electrons and results of calculation are given
